Find the perimeter of trapezoid WXYZ with vertices W(2, 3), X(4, 6), Y(7, 6), and Z(7,3). Leave your answer in simplest radical

form.

Answer:

Perimeter = 11 + \sqrt{13}

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the perimeter of WXYZ we need to find the length of all four sides: WX, XY, YZ and WZ.

To find the length of each side, we can use the formula for the distance of two points:

distance = \sqrt{(x_1 - x_2)^2 + (y_1 - y_2)^2}

So we have that:

WX = \sqrt{(2 - 4)^2 + (3 - 6)^2} = \sqrt{13}

XY = \sqrt{(4 - 7)^2 + (6 - 6)^2} = 3

YZ = \sqrt{(7 - 7)^2 + (6 - 3)^2} = 3

WZ = \sqrt{(2 - 7)^2 + (3 - 3)^2} = 5

The perimeter is:

Perimeter = WX + XY + YZ + WZ

Perimeter = \sqrt{13}  + 3 + 3 + 5 =11 + \sqrt{13}

The limit of sqrt(9x^4 + 1)/(x^2 - 3x + 5) as x approaches infinity is
Lerok [7]

Answer:

B. 3.

Step-by-step explanation:

At the limit we can take the numerator  to be √(9x^4) = 3x^2

The function is of the form ∞/ ∞ as x approaches ∞ so we can apply l'hopitals rule:

Differentiating top and bottom we have   6x / 2x - 3. Differentiating again we get 6 / 2 = 3.

Our limit as x  approaches infinity  is 3.
